Spanish fruit and vegetable imports grew by over 5% up to June
2023-08-31 00:00
Spanish imports of fresh fruit and vegetables increased by 5.5% in volume up to June, totalling 311,423 tonnes, and by 17.5% in value, with 329 million euros.

LA UNIÓ warns of the presence of a new white fly in France
2023-08-30 00:00
This quarantine pest, which was detected in June on French territory, originating from South-East Asia, has so far been localised in 14 municipalities - with 5 more to be confirmed - in the Occitania region of France.

The colour of the banana does matter
2023-08-29 00:00
High temperatures in summer accelerate the ripening of bananas, which, in turn, causes a shortening of their commercial life because they tend to turn black earlier than in times of lower temperatures.

Cora Seeds acquires the onion and pumpkin programmes of KWS
2023-08-25 00:00
Italian seed house Cora Seeds has acquired the onion and pumpkin programmes of the KWS Group, a 160-year-old company specialising in research and production of seeds for various crops with a turnover of more than 1.5 billion euros and more than 5,100 employees in the EU.
